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- Most frequently, the finishing of metal is needed for appearance as well as clean-room applications. It really is one of the more popular practices due to its utility in intensifying the natural beauty of the items, as an example, kitchenware, car parts or motorbike parts. What's more, lots of clean-rooms demand a sleek finish as a way to limit the penetrability of the material that will cause dust to build up and contaminate. A superb example of this practice might be in a vacuum chamber.

You will find many methods of finish metal, and we can examine some of the processes involved. Metal can be finished using chemicals, electromechanically, with purpose built buffing machines, or simply manually. A special finishing compound or paste can be employed, which might contain ch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its mediocre th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scidity is among the most time intensive. However, goods composed of non-ferrous metal are generally more receptive to buffing, simply because these need the lower number of treatments.

A decreased pad speed must be used any time a high quality mirror finish is required. Finishing buffs covered in compound can be greatly affected by specific pressure on the finishing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face could be elevated to a specific limit, but applying above the most effective measure of pressure not just cuts down the quality level of the process, but in addition lessens the level of performance, can create wear on the part, plus there is also an obvious heating up of the work-pieces, as a consequence of friction. For thin metal, it will be increased heat (and a corresponding flexibility of the material) that cause elements to flex, bend or warp. Ordinarily, it requires a competent polisher to consider each one of these things to equally prevent damage to the part and to perform the job successfully. To appreciably increase the quality of the resulting finish, the finishing action must really be performed with considerably less vigour and not so much pressure in an effort to finally produce a surface devoid of scores or marks which result from the buffing procedure, subsequently ending up with a beautiful mirror finish.
